22nd St - Al Barsha - Al Barsha 1 - Dubai - United Arab Emirates
Call
Website
Mall of Emirates Unit No. J22-24 First Floor - Dubai - United Arab Emirates
Call
Website
Doha Centre - Al Maktoum Rd - Deira - Dubai - United Arab Emirates
Call
Website
JBR Sadaf Walk GM-05 - Dubai - United Arab Emirates
Call
Website
564X+MQ2 - Al Quoz - Al Quoz 4 - Dubai - United Arab Emirates